From 92a59e76c33b284b22b1e455790e459f7fbfa536 Mon Sep 17 00:00:00 2001 From: Miles Yucht Date: Wed, 29 Nov 2023 13:34:31 +0100 Subject: [PATCH] Release v0.13.0 Bug fixes: * Fix databricks CLI authentication on Windows ([#192](https://github.com/databricks/databricks-sdk-java/pull/192)). * Fix SCIM pagination ([#193](https://github.com/databricks/databricks-sdk-java/pull/193)). Other changes: * Add more detailed error message on default credentials not found error ([#180](https://github.com/databricks/databricks-sdk-java/pull/180)). * Support custom scopes and redirectUrl for U2M OAuth flow ([#190](https://github.com/databricks/databricks-sdk-java/pull/190)). API Changes: * Removed `enableOptimization()` method for `workspaceClient.metastores()` service. * Added `pipelineId` field for `com.databricks.sdk.service.catalog.TableInfo`. * Added `enablePredictiveOptimization` field for `com.databricks.sdk.service.catalog.UpdateCatalog` and `com.databricks.sdk.service.catalog.UpdateSchema`. * Removed `com.databricks.sdk.service.catalog.UpdatePredictiveOptimization` and `com.databricks.sdk.service.catalog.UpdatePredictiveOptimizationResponse` class. * Added `description` field for `com.databricks.sdk.service.jobs.CreateJob` and `com.databricks.sdk.service.jobs.JobSettings`. * Added `listNetworkConnectivityConfigurations()` and `listPrivateEndpointRules()` methods for `accountClient.networkConnectivity()` service. * Added `com.databricks.sdk.service.settings.ListNccAzurePrivateEndpointRulesResponse`, `com.databricks.sdk.service.settings.ListNetworkConnectivityConfigurationsRequest`, `com.databricks.sdk.service.settings.ListNetworkConnectivityConfigurationsResponse`, and `com.databricks.sdk.service.settings.ListPrivateEndpointRulesRequest` classes. * Added `stringSharedAs` field for `com.databricks.sdk.service.sharing.SharedDataObject`. OpenAPI SHA: 22f09783eb8a84d52026f856be3b2068f9498db3, Date: 2023-11-23 Dependency updates: * Bump API spec: 23 Nov 2023 ([#191](https://github.com/databricks/databricks-sdk-java/pull/191)). --- CHANGELOG.md | 29 +++++++++++++++++++ databricks-sdk-java/pom.xml | 2 +- .../com/databricks/sdk/core/UserAgent.java | 2 +- pom.xml | 2 +- 4 files changed, 32 insertions(+), 3 deletions(-) diff --git a/CHANGELOG.md b/CHANGELOG.md index 00a6270e1..942aa992d 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-1,5 +1,34 @@ # Version changelog +## 0.13.0 + +Bug fixes: + +* Fix databricks CLI authentication on Windows ([#192](https://github.com/databricks/databricks-sdk-java/pull/192)). +* Fix SCIM pagination ([#193](https://github.com/databricks/databricks-sdk-java/pull/193)). + +Other changes: + +* Add more detailed error message on default credentials not found error ([#180](https://github.com/databricks/databricks-sdk-java/pull/180)). +* Support custom scopes and redirectUrl for U2M OAuth flow ([#190](https://github.com/databricks/databricks-sdk-java/pull/190)). + +API Changes: + + * Removed `enableOptimization()` method for `workspaceClient.metastores()` service. + * Added `pipelineId` field for `com.databricks.sdk.service.catalog.TableInfo`. + * Added `enablePredictiveOptimization` field for `com.databricks.sdk.service.catalog.UpdateCatalog` and `com.databricks.sdk.service.catalog.UpdateSchema`. + * Removed `com.databricks.sdk.service.catalog.UpdatePredictiveOptimization` and `com.databricks.sdk.service.catalog.UpdatePredictiveOptimizationResponse` class. + * Added `description` field for `com.databricks.sdk.service.jobs.CreateJob` and `com.databricks.sdk.service.jobs.JobSettings`. + * Added `listNetworkConnectivityConfigurations()` and `listPrivateEndpointRules()` methods for `accountClient.networkConnectivity()` service. + * Added `com.databricks.sdk.service.settings.ListNccAzurePrivateEndpointRulesResponse`, `com.databricks.sdk.service.settings.ListNetworkConnectivityConfigurationsRequest`, `com.databricks.sdk.service.settings.ListNetworkConnectivityConfigurationsResponse`, and `com.databricks.sdk.service.settings.ListPrivateEndpointRulesRequest` classes. + * Added `stringSharedAs` field for `com.databricks.sdk.service.sharing.SharedDataObject`. + +OpenAPI SHA: 22f09783eb8a84d52026f856be3b2068f9498db3, Date: 2023-11-23 + +Dependency updates: + + * Bump API spec: 23 Nov 2023 ([#191](https://github.com/databricks/databricks-sdk-java/pull/191)). + ## 0.12.0 * Implemented notebook-native auth for the Java SDK ([#171](https://github.com/databricks/databricks-sdk-java/pull/171)). diff --git a/databricks-sdk-java/pom.xml b/databricks-sdk-java/pom.xml index cac65c687..b51fc5606 100644 --- a/databricks-sdk-java/pom.xml +++ b/databricks-sdk-java/pom.xml @@ -5,7 +5,7 @@ com.databricks databricks-sdk-parent - 0.12.0 + 0.13.0 databricks-sdk-java diff --git a/databricks-sdk-java/src/main/java/com/databricks/sdk/core/UserAgent.java b/databricks-sdk-java/src/main/java/com/databricks/sdk/core/UserAgent.java index c0d9dac12..b4abd8c9f 100644 --- a/databricks-sdk-java/src/main/java/com/databricks/sdk/core/UserAgent.java +++ b/databricks-sdk-java/src/main/java/com/databricks/sdk/core/UserAgent.java @@ -13,7 +13,7 @@ public class UserAgent { // TODO: check if reading from // /META-INF/maven/com.databricks/databrics-sdk-java/pom.properties // or getClass().getPackage().getImplementationVersion() is enough. - private static final String version = "0.12.0"; + private static final String version = "0.13.0"; public static void withProduct(String product, String productVersion) { UserAgent.product = product; diff --git a/pom.xml b/pom.xml index 6d8120cc4..81f5abdf5 100644 --- a/pom.xml +++ b/pom.xml @@ -4,7 +4,7 @@ 4.0.0 com.databricks databricks-sdk-parent - 0.12.0 + 0.13.0 pom Databricks SDK for Java The Databricks SDK for Java includes functionality to accelerate development with Java for